Shri Piyush Goyal Launches Ujala Scheme in Goa and Vidyut Pravah & Urja Mobile App

Union Minister of State (IC) for Power, Coal and New and Renewable Energy Shri Piyush Goyal today launched 'URJA'- Urban Jyoti Abhiyaan Mobile app on the side-lines of ongoing two day Conference of Power Ministers at Cansaulim in South Goa. The app is developed by Power Finance Corporation on behalf of Ministry of Power for Urban Power Distribution Sector to enhance consumer connect with the Urban Power Distribution sector by providing information of IT enabled towns on important parameters which concern the consumers like outage information, timely release of connections, addressing complaints, power reliability etc.

The app will work as manifestation of Prime Minister's principle of good governance i.e. People focus, co-operative federalism.

The Union Minister also launched the Pradhan Mantri UJALA (Unnat Jyoti by Affordable LED for all) Yojana in Goa with a target of replacing approximately 15 lakh LED bulbs, impacting nearly 5 lakh households. Under the scheme, consumers are entitled to 3 LED bulbs of 9W each at a subsidized rate of Rs.25/, as against a market price of Rs.300-350.

The Scheme launched in the distinguished presence of Goa Chief Minister Shri Laxmikant Parsekar will help save over 78 million kwh every year in the state and about Rs.850-1000 on annual electricity bills.

Besides, the Union Minister also launched Vidyut Pravah App at the event.

Speaking on the occasion the Minister said the scope of DEEP (Discovery of Efficient Electricity Price) e-Bidding and e-Reverse Auction Portal has been further expanded by covering banking mechanism and the medium term procurement of Power. The Union Minister said the Government will soon start 100 percent smart metering to curb the menace of power theft. He said currently there is a loss around 24 to 26 percent due to theft of Power.

The two day conference is expected to deliberate on Coal related issues, Hydropower policy, transmission related issues behind other issues.
